Transaction 005753898e9516f3e6474924cdc6645983aebb995beccce78bee585238b49ea4
2 Input
2 Outputs
- 005753898e9516f3e6474924cdc6645983aebb995beccce78bee585238b49ea4:0
- 005753898e9516f3e6474924cdc6645983aebb995beccce78bee585238b49ea4:1
value 189348381
address 37K8PfWdb3DR3t2tBZjoeGVBHgwszjTP3u
value 180914051
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w